20090040240 | Hovering table headers - A method, system and computer-usable medium are disclosed for displaying header information in a table. One or more cells of a table are selected and their associated header information is determined and replicated. Display attributes are then applied to the replicated header information resulting in the generation of a table header that overlays adjacent table cells. In one embodiment, the resulting table header is dynamically invoked through a user gesture. In another embodiment, the resulting table header is persistently displayed and comprises a viewing window that displays information contained in the selected table cells. The persistent table header moves with the cursor as it is positioned over other table cells and displays the information they contain. Display attributes such as ghosting are applied to other table cells to generate a visually distinguished table header that facilitates visual correlation between selected table cells and their corresponding header information. | 02-12-2009 |
20100097403 | INPUT SHORTCUTS FOR A COMMUNICATIONS DEVICE - A method of inputting an electronic address into an address field on a communications device, the electronic address including a plurality of text characters and non-text symbol characters. The method includes: receiving a plurality of inputs for the address field through a user input interface of the device; adding text characters to the address field corresponding to the inputs; and detecting among the inputs repetitive successive inputs of a predetermined delimiter, selecting a non-text symbol character from a set of non-text symbol characters in dependence on a number of times the delimiter has been repetitively input without any intervening inputs, and adding the selected non-text symbol character to the address field. | 04-22-2010 |
20110018905 | PRINTED CIRCUIT BOARD LAYOUT SYSTEM AND METHOD FOR ADJUSTING CHARACTER ORIENTATION THEREOF - A printed circuit board layout system includes a layout module, an acquiring module, and an adjusting module. The layout module creates a PCB layout diagram file based on a circuit schematic diagram. The PCB layout diagram file includes characters and orientation angles associated with the characters. The acquiring module acquires the characters and the orientation angles of the corresponding characters in response to a user input. The adjusting module adjusts the orientation angles of the characters to a predetermined angle. | 01-27-2011 |
20110157236 | HEAD-MOUNTED DISPLAY - A head-mounted display includes an image display that is mounted on the head of a user and permits the user to visually recognize an image, input detector that is mounted on the body of the user to detect coordinates of input by a user in a detection area, an image generation unit that generates a trajectory image of the input based on the coordinates of input and output this generated trajectory image to the image display, a displacement determination unit that determines a relative displacement of the character written into the detection area from the coordinates of input, and a position correction unit that corrects the displacement of the character based on the displacement. | 06-30-2011 |

20160063747 | METHOD TO CREATE DISPLAY SCREENS FOR A CONTROLLER USED IN A BUILDING AUTOMATION SYSTEM - A controller for controlling components in a building automation system including a processor, a display operably coupled to the processor, a memory operably coupled to the processor, and executable software stored in the memory, the executable software operable to display at least one textual element on the display, wherein the at least one textual element is sized based a maximum character parameter. A method of operating a software module configured to create display elements for a controller, the method including operating the module to: create at least one textual element, place at least one character within the at least one textual element to form a word, select at least one support language for the at least one textual element, determine a maximum character parameter, and size the at least one textual element based at least in part on the maximum character parameter. | 03-03-2016 |
20160163079 | Electronic Greeting Card System - The present invention provides an electronic greeting card (“e-card”) system that allows the sender to modify the original dialogue of the e-card. This unique personalized e-card feature is different from the sender's conventional ability to create personalized content in the card from scratch. The system also contains the ability to organize sent and draft e-cards through a save to folder option, the ability to restrict ownership to only the sender who purchased the e-card, an optional gift card that is both visual and wrapped, and an opening date where the recipient cannot open the e-card and/or the gift card until the opening date arrives. | 06-09-2016 |
